Bacon Flavored Double Cheeseburger Meatloaf

Crumbled bits of bacon and a heaping helping of Cheddar cheese join a bit of other hamburger condiments to flavor this delicious meatloaf.
Ready in
1 hour 15 mins
Added to favorites by 83 cooks
Ingredients
Serves : 7
1 egg
1 large sweet onion, chopped
1 1/2 pounds ground beef
1/4 cup mayonnaise
6 slices cooked, crumbled bacon
1 cup firm white bread crumbs
1 cup shredded Cheddar cheese
2 tablespoons sweet pickle relish
2 teaspoons dry mustard powder
1/2 teaspoon seasoned salt
1/2 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per
1/4 cup ketchup
Preparation method
Prep:
15 mins
|
Cook: 1 hour
1.
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
2.
Mix the egg and onion together in a mixing bowl to break up the egg. Work in the ground beef, mayonnaise, bacon, bread crumbs, cheese, relish, salt and pepper. Mix with your hands until evenly combined, then pack into a loaf pan.
3.
Spread the top of the meatloaf with ketchup. Bake in the preheated oven until a meat thermometer inserted into the center registers at least 160 degrees F, about 1 hour.
